Synthesis of oligosaccharides of therapeutic interest

Shiga toxin-producing Escherichia coli (STEC) cause severe gastrointestinal infections ranging in severity from mild diarrhea to hemorrhagic colitis, which can progress to life-threatening hemolytic uremic syndrome (HUS). The E. coli O157:H7 serotype is the most frequently isolated in industrialized countries. One of the toxins appears to exhibit a preference for the P1 antigen (Galα1-4Galβ1-4GlcNAcβ1-3Galβ1-4Glc), and more specifically for the terminal trisaccharide Galα1-4Galβ1-4GlcNAc. This motif is therefore a key element for the design of compounds of therapeutic interest.

In this context, it is important to have access to these oligosaccharides of interest and possessing a reactive function in a non-reducing position of the allyl, 3-aminopropyl or propargyl type for subsequent conjugations on surfaces with a fluorophore or any other entity. The targeted oligosaccharides are therefore the terminal trisaccharide Galα1-4Galβ1-4GlcNAc and the complete pentasaccharide of the natural P1 antigen Galα1-4Galβ1-4GlcNAcβ1-3Galβ1-4Glc. The synthesis will be carried out through a synergy between organic (glyco)chemistry, developed at ICSN, and biotechnology, leveraging the expertise of the company Elicityl, to access the substructures of these oligosaccharides. A unified synthesis strategy will be based on access to large quantities (up to 1 kg) of N-acetyl-lactosamine and lactose by Elicityl, which represent the two starting materials necessary for these syntheses.

Contexte de travail

The Institute of Chemistry of Natural Substances is a CNRS Research Unit whose research focuses are chemistry and biology. It is part of the University of Paris-Saclay, which has brought together, since 2015, the research and teaching establishments of southern Paris. The ICSN is located on the Gif-sur-Yvette campus and has approximately 124 employees, including 71 permanent staff, spread over 3 buildings. Within the Chemobiology Department, the recruited employee will join the "Probes and Modulators for Biological Targets" team made up of approximately 15 people. He will be placed under the hierarchical authority of the team leader and the project will be carried out under the co-direction of Dr. Sébastien Vidal and Dr. Stéphanie Norsikian. The laboratory is equipped with all the necessary instruments for the project (HPLC, automatic flash chromatography, microwave synthesis reactor, freeze dryer, rotavap, etc.). Several analytical platforms are present in the institute and provide cutting-edge instruments: NMR (300, 500 MHz), mass spectrometry (LCMS, HRMS) and X-ray diffraction in particular.
